I have just implemented an Avenue TRAM system in my city. Ridership is great (in the thousands) but I now I have a new problem: For some reason ALL of the traffic that previosly used the avenue (except for some which park and ride at the tram stations) now turn off right before any station and continue on a sidestreet that parallels the avenue. At the next available turn after the station, the traffic natually heads back to the avenue, as mandated by my NAM controller. Now i have seroious traffic issues on that sidestreet, which serves a rather dense residential area, and no obvious way to deal with it. Is there something wrong with the tram station, or do I have to drag some network over the station, like with regular GLR stations?

These are the tram stations in use. All three exhibit this problem.

Shmails GLR in Avenue Station #1

SFBT Historic Avenue Tram Station (from SC4Devotion I believe)

TSC Tram Station

You might try running one-way roads throught the glr-in-avenue station tiles to create the paths (saving, exiting, and re-entering the game has the same effect). You could check the paths through the stations by using the "Drawpaths" cheat to see if the paths are there.

    Originally posted by: Citymaster13

    Does it give high (10000+) capacities for GLR and AvGLR stations? I find that in my cities the stations tend to get used up very quickly.quote>

    It sure does. In fact, all of the high capacity versions of RTMT stations have capacities in excess of 10,000. RTMT is designed so that its stations never go over capacity before their containing networks.

    Also, as I have pointed out in another thread, mass transit station capacities are actually at least four times higher than their stated capacities, and no service degradation at all occurs before this higher number is reached.

    A further note...

    In response to citymaster's post, I tried out the TSC and Gshmail's Avenue stations. Both seem to not function completely. It seems riders can't "get on" trams. Traffic passes through, but no new el-rail riders are added at the stations. Traffic can exit the stations, however, being transferred to bus or pedestrian. Anyone else notice this (maybe it's just me)?

    As Z mentioned, the RTMT lots can be used with those models and function fine.
